Senior Technical Advisor

Chris Fetters

 

CEO, Louisiana 23 Development Company

 

Mr. Fetters established LA23 after over 20 years in the engineering and consulting industries, where he managed project portfolios in infrastructure, energy, environmental, regulatory, and litigation support.  

 

Chris began his career with the US Army Corps of Engineers at the Engineering Research and Development Center. During that time, he focused on developing innovative technologies for various remediation purposes. The mission of the ERDC station was to support active and reserve military stations for the Department of Defense. After leaving ERDC, Mr. Fetters primarily worked in the environmental, regulatory, and engineering consulting fields. During that time, he transitioned from project manager at Michael Pisani & Associates to a principal and vice president at GHD. While at the global firm, Mr. Fetters was placed as the Principal-in-Charge of the North American initiative for Ports and Harbors. This work included the introduction to Public-Private Partnerships and the utilization of private funding for large-scale infrastructure projects.  Before LA23, Mr. Fetters served as the Director for Ports for GIS Engineering, where his focus was on the coastal energy ports in Louisiana. Specifically, his focus was on identifying alternative financial mechanisms to overcome funding shortfalls for strategic operation and maintenance.  

 

Mr. Fetters earned a Bachelor of Science in Chemistry from Pittsburg State University and a Master of Science in Chemical Engineering from Mississippi State University.
